theute Dec 6, 2006 2:35 AM (in response to vietanh.vu)Because the render phase must have no side-effect.
And the JSR 168 tells that you cannot rely on obtaining the request parameters on render calls, only render parameters. -

julien1 Dec 6, 2006 4:57 AM (in response to vietanh.vu)Actually I read several posts of your blog, in particular the POST/GET with form. Here is the main reason of why we don't want to have FORM+GET :
The problem of FORM GET is that there is no specification that says how the browsers should merge the parameters of the URL of the form to submit with the form fields.
As the portal may encode data in the URL parameters, depending on the browsers, those parameters may be discarded partially or completely and the portal request may not be able to occur.
